
About Veeva Systems
Cloud solutions tailored for life sciences success
Key Highlights
- Public company (NYSE: VEEV) - strong equity potential
- Over 800 customers including AstraZeneca and emerging biotechs
- Headquartered in Pleasanton, CA with 1001+ employees
- Launched Veeva Compass Suite in 2024 for enhanced patient insights
Veeva Systems (NYSE: VEEV) is a leading provider of cloud-based software specifically designed for the life sciences industry. Headquartered in Pleasanton, CA, Veeva serves over 800 customers, including major pharmaceutical companies like AstraZeneca and emerging biotechs. The company is known for i...
🎁 Benefits
Veeva offers a 2% salary contribution towards personal development, childcare vouchers, and a flexible work-from-anywhere policy. Employees also benef...
🌟 Culture
Veeva's culture is deeply rooted in its commitment to the life sciences sector, focusing on operational efficiency and innovation. The company emphasi...
Skills & Technologies
Overview
Veeva Systems is hiring a Senior Frontend Engineer to develop and maintain the UI of cloud-based applications. You'll work with modern JavaScript frameworks and collaborate with backend and design teams. This position requires experience in a fast-paced environment.
Job Description
Who you are
You are a Senior Frontend Engineer with a strong background in modern JavaScript frameworks — you thrive in collaborative environments and enjoy building user interfaces that enhance user experience. You have a passion for developing high-quality software and are eager to contribute to a mission-driven organization. Your experience in a fast-paced, startup-like environment has equipped you with the skills to adapt quickly and deliver results efficiently. You are a team player who values communication and collaboration, working closely with backend engineers and designers to create seamless applications.
You have a solid understanding of frontend technologies and best practices — your expertise in JavaScript and frameworks like React allows you to build responsive and dynamic user interfaces. You are committed to writing clean, maintainable code and are always looking for ways to improve your development processes. You understand the importance of user-centric design and are excited to contribute to projects that have a meaningful impact on the life sciences industry.
What you'll do
In this role, you will be responsible for developing and maintaining the user interface of Veeva's cloud-based applications — you will collaborate with backend engineers to integrate APIs and ensure a smooth user experience. You will participate in rapid development sprints, contributing to the design and implementation of new features while maintaining existing functionality. Your role will involve working closely with design teams to translate wireframes and mockups into functional user interfaces that meet user needs.
You will also be involved in code reviews and contribute to the overall improvement of the team's coding standards — your insights will help shape the development practices within the team. As a Senior Frontend Engineer, you will mentor junior engineers, sharing your knowledge and experience to help them grow in their roles. You will have the opportunity to work on complex problems that directly impact the speed and effectiveness of the life sciences industry, making a positive difference in the lives of patients.
What we offer
Veeva Systems offers a flexible work environment, allowing you to choose between working from home or in the office — we believe that you should thrive in your ideal setting. As a mission-driven organization, we are committed to making a positive impact on our customers, employees, and communities. You will be part of a rapidly growing SaaS company with extensive growth potential, and you will have the chance to work on innovative projects that are transforming the life sciences industry. We encourage you to apply even if your experience doesn't match every requirement, as we value diverse perspectives and backgrounds.
Interested in this role?
Apply now or save it for later. Get alerts for similar jobs at Veeva Systems.
Similar Jobs You Might Like
Based on your interests and this role

Frontend Engineer
Veeva Systems is hiring a Senior Frontend Engineer to develop and maintain the UI of cloud-based applications. You'll work with modern JavaScript frameworks in a collaborative environment. This position requires experience in frontend development.

Frontend Engineer
Veeva Systems is hiring a Frontend Engineer to develop and maintain the UI of cloud-based applications. You'll work with modern JavaScript frameworks like React in a collaborative environment. This position requires experience in frontend development.

Frontend Engineer
Veeva Systems is hiring a Frontend Engineer to develop and maintain the UI of their cloud-based applications. You'll work with modern JavaScript frameworks like React in a collaborative environment. This position requires experience in frontend development.

Frontend Engineer
Veeva Systems is hiring a Senior Frontend Engineer to develop and maintain the UI of their cloud-based applications. You'll work with modern JavaScript frameworks like React in a collaborative environment. This position requires experience in frontend development.

Frontend Engineer
Veeva Systems is hiring a Senior Frontend Engineer to develop and maintain the UI of their cloud-based applications. You'll work with modern JavaScript frameworks like React in Vancouver. This position requires strong collaboration skills and experience in a fast-paced environment.